Phil Collins and Genesis bandmembers sell music rights in $300+ million deal

British rock band Genesis

Genesis's most popular 80's songs include "Invisible Touch," "That's All" and "Land of Confusion." Collins' massively-popular solo career, which won him eight Grammys, includes the songs "In The Air Tonight", "Against All Odds " and "Another Day in Paradise". Concord Music Group's president said that the company plans to cash in on the band's 80's pop hits by introducing them to younger generations.

The deal came after the market for music rights exploded during the COVID-19 pandemic, attracting investors who sought long-term, reliable income from streaming services like Spotify and Apple Music.
